Someone very important in my life was a man named Rex Riddle. He was four<br />

“est”” things to me. He was the nicest, kindest, and gentlest man I‟ve ever known. He<br />

was also the biggest. Six-nine, three-hundred twenty-five pounds, that was Rex.<br />

He was the “baby” of a family of six boys, although he was the biggest of them<br />

all. The “runt” in that group, as I understand it, was six-two. Rex was part white, part<br />

black, and part Native American, on his mother‟s side. In all the years I knew him, I<br />

never once heard Rex swear, or use a dirty word. No vulgarity of any kind. He‟d say,<br />

“Oh, gosh!”, or, “<strong>My</strong>, my”, “Golly!” He never used bad words for any reason. Only two<br />

things I was aware of could get him angry.<br />

However, when he did get angry, any man I‟ve ever met would pray he wasn‟t the<br />

reason Rex got pissed off. Rex would be infuriated if anyone hurt a friend of his. No<br />

matter why the other guy was doing it, even if he was “entitled” by our code, Rex<br />

wouldn‟t allow it. He‟d always step in and finish it for his friend.<br />
